Redis工作原理Redis介绍 Redis是一个key-value存储系统,它支持的value类型相对较多,包括string、list、set和zset,这些数据都支持push/pop/add/remove及交并补等操作,而且这些操作都是原子性的,在此基础上,redis支持各种不同方式的排序。为了保证效率,数据是缓存在内存中的,Redis会周期性的把数据写入磁盘或者把修改操作写入追加的记录
转载 2023-05-25 10:56:26
48阅读
# Redis技术介绍 ## 简介 Redis是一个开源的内存数据结构存储系统,它可以用作数据库、缓存和消息中间件。Redis支持多种数据结构,包括字符串(strings)、哈希(hashes)、列表(lists)、集合(sets)、有序集合(sorted sets)等。Redis的特点是速度快、响应时间低、支持丰富的数据结构和灵活的持久化选项。 ## 安装和启动 你可以使用以下命令安装R
原创 2023-07-23 08:56:02
40阅读
一、Redis1. Redis的特点?Redis是由意大利人Salvatore Sanfilippo(网名:antirez)开发的一款内存高速缓存数据库。Redis全称为:Remote Dictionary Server(远程数据服务),该软件使用C语言编写,典型的NoSQL数据库服务器,Redis是一个key-value存储系统,它支持丰富的数据类型,如:string、list、set、zset
转载 2023-11-14 15:11:42
45阅读
一.Redis简介Redis 是完全开源免费的,是一个高性能的key-value类型的内存数据库。整个数据库统统加载在内存当中进行操作,定期通过异步操作把数据库数据flush到硬盘上进行保存。因为是纯内存操作,Redis的性能非常出色,每秒可以处理超过 10万次读写操作,是已知性能最快的Key-Value DB。Redis的出色之处不仅仅是性能,Redis最大的魅力是支持保存多种数据结构,此外单个
转载 2023-06-26 14:12:48
66阅读
目录1、Redis简介2、Redis主要能做什么3、Redis和Memcached的区别以及与其他数据库的区别4、Redis的五种数据类型5、Redis的持久化功能RDB(快照)AOF(只追加文件)6、Redis的数据淘汰策略7、Redis的主从复制1、Redis简介Redis全称为Remote Dictionary Server(远程数据服务),是一款开源的基于内存的键值对存储系统,其主要被用作
转载 2023-07-07 15:12:33
104阅读
1、缓存String类型例如:热点数据缓存(例如报表、明星出轨),对象缓存、全页缓存、可以提升热点数据的访问数据。2、数据共享分布式String 类型,因为 Redis 是分布式的独立服务,可以在多个应用之间共享例如:分布式Session<dependency> <groupId>org.springframework.session</groupId>
      REmote DIctionary Server(远程字典服务器)。是完全开源免费的,用C语言编写的, 遵守BCD协议。是一个高性能的(key/value)分布式内存数据库,基于内存运行并支持持久化的NoSQL数据库,是当前最热门的NoSql数据库之一,也被人们称为数据结构服务器。一、Redis基本原理 redis的特点:&n
转载 2023-07-04 17:11:12
48阅读
Redis 技术总结一、Redis 数据类型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合)。参考:数据类型二、Redis 应用场景1、缓存2、分布式 锁3、自增码参考文章参考三、Redis 主从复制、集群、哨兵机制原理参考参考1四、分布式锁参考文章五、分布式缓
转载 2024-04-19 11:45:28
19阅读
1.什么是redis?REmote DIctionry Server(redis) 是一个由C语言编写的完全开源的,高性能的Key-Value存储系统。2.redis的特点?      1.redis支持数据的持久化,可以将内存中的数据保存在磁盘中,重启的时候可以再次加载进行使用。       2.redis不仅仅支持简单的ke
转载 2023-12-18 21:30:54
36阅读
适用于如下场景:对数据高并发处理对大数据高效率存储和访问对数据高可用及高扩展Redis是NoSQL数据库的一种Redis是以KV方式存储数据库特点:非关系,分布,开源,可扩展,高速内存操作。适合运行在廉价的pc服务器上分布式处理海量数据Redis是一个开源的,先进的kv存储方式的数据库,通常叫数据结构服务器,键可以包含字符串strings,哈希hashes,lists链表,集合sets,有序集合s
转载 2023-11-25 10:54:20
33阅读
Redis 管道技术 Redis是一种基于客户端-服务端模型以及请求/响应协议的TCP服务。这意味着通常情况下一个请求会遵循以下步骤: 客户端向服务端发送一个查询请求,并监听Socket返回,通常是以阻塞模式,等待服务端响应。 服务端处理命令,并将结果返回给客户端。 Redis 管道技术 Redis 管道技术可以在服务端未响应时,客户端可以继续向服务端发送请求,并最终一次性读取所有服务端的响...
原创 2021-07-21 11:28:03
177阅读
# Redis技术笔记的实现 ## 1. 整体流程 在实现Redis技术笔记的过程中,我们需要完成以下步骤: | 步骤 | 描述 | | --- | --- | | 1 | 安装Redis | | 2 | 连接Redis | | 3 | 创建笔记 | | 4 | 读取笔记 | | 5 | 更新笔记 | | 6 | 删除笔记 | | 7 | 关闭连接 | 下面将逐步展开每一步的具体操作。
原创 2023-08-20 08:40:14
16阅读
Redis是一种基于客户端-服务端模型以及请求/响应协议的TCP服务。这意味着通常情况下一个请求会遵循以下步骤: 客户端向服务端发送一个查询请求,并监听Socket返回,通常是以阻塞模式,等待服务端响应。 服务端处理命令,并将结果返回给客户端。 Redis 管道技术 Redis 管道技术可以在服务端
原创 2018-02-21 14:46:00
199阅读
Redis 是一种开源的高性能键值存储数据库,广泛应用于缓存、实时分析、消息队列等场景。今天我们将深入探讨 Redis 在各种技术场景中的作用,具体涵盖备份策略、恢复流程、灾难场景、工具链集成、迁移方案和最佳实践。 ### 备份策略 我们首先来看如何制定有效的备份策略,确保我们的数据安全和可用性。在 Redis 中,备份通常包括 RDB 和 AOF 两种形式。接下来,我们用流程图表示整个备份过
原创 5月前
20阅读
Redis是一种基于客户端-服务端模型以及请求/响应协议的TCP服务。这意味着通常情况下一个请求会遵循以下步骤: 客户端向服务端发送一个查询请求,并监听Socket返回,通常是以阻塞模式,等待服务端响应。 服务端处理命令,并将结果返回给客户端。 Redis 管道技术 Redis 管道技术可以在服务端
转载 2018-11-03 10:46:00
83阅读
# Redis技术实现:缓存与数据存储的高效解决方案 Redis(Remote Dictionary Server)是一个开源的,基于内存的高性能键值存储系统。它支持多种类型的数据结构,如字符串、列表、集合、散列、有序集合等,并且具备原子操作、持久化、复制和高可用性等功能。本文将通过代码示例,介绍Redis的基本使用和一些技术实现细节。 ## 环境搭建 首先,我们需要安装Redis。可以从[
原创 2024-07-29 11:12:48
16阅读
# Redis 技术选型指南 Redis 是一种高性能的键值存储数据库,广泛应用于缓存、数据持久化和消息队列等多种场景。在选择 Redis 作为技术方案之前,我们需要做出一系列的步骤和分析,确保它能够满足我们的需求。本文将以流程图的方式展示 Redis 技术选型的步骤,并详细说明每一步需要的实现代码及其注释。 ## Redis 技术选型流程 以下是选型过程的基本步骤: | 步骤
原创 10月前
87阅读
# Redis技术特点及应用示例 Redis(Remote Dictionary Server)是一个开源的高性能键值存储系统,以其出色的性能、丰富的数据结构和灵活的持久化机制而广受欢迎。本文将介绍Redis技术特点,并结合代码示例和流程图,帮助读者更好地理解和应用Redis。 ## Redis技术特点 1. **高性能**:Redis是基于内存操作的,读写速度极快,能够达到每秒数十万次的
原创 2024-07-17 04:09:16
47阅读
1.redis为啥这么快基于内存使用单线程,避免了线程切换,同时保证了原子性使用复合IO,非阻塞IO使用高级数据结构,比如sds2.为什么redis使用单线程官方回答是,Redis 是基于内存的操作,CPU 不会成为 Redis 的瓶颈,而最有可能是机器内存的大小或者网络带宽。既然单线程容易实现,而且 CPU 不会成为瓶颈,那就顺理成章地采用单线程的方案了。使用单线程,就避免了各种锁,就减少了很多
转载 2024-09-03 23:24:59
84阅读
Redis中用户通过执行slaveof命令或者设置slaveof选项,让一个服务器去复制另一个服务器。被复制的称为主服务器(master),复制的称为从服务器(slave)。1,旧版复制功能及其缺点redis的复制功能,分为同步和命令传播两个操作: 同步:将从服务器的状态更新至主服务器目前所处的状态 命令传播:主服务器对数据库状态进行修改导致主从服务器状态不一致时,让主从服务器数据库恢复至统一
  • 1
  • 2
  • 3
  • 4
  • 5